“Aoi” is a striking song by Polkadot Stingray that leaves a vivid impression.
Chosen as the ending theme for Godzilla Singular Point, it captivates with a power that seems to embody the anime’s world.
The energetic guitar riffs and bass lines seize our hearts in an instant, while the drum beats—like Godzilla’s roar—send tremors through the senses.
On top of that, Shizuku’s unique lyrics and emotive vocals have a deep resonance with the listener’s feelings.
It’s a piece that paints a breathtaking story while making you want to surrender to the rhythm.

This is a track included on their first album, Omniscience Omnipotence.
It’s based on an incident that could happen to anyone: getting drunk, going to sleep, and waking up to find a stranger next to you.
The confused-sounding guitar and Shizuku’s vocal delivery really convey a sense of inebriation.
